收藏 分享(赏)

视觉传感器在S7300中的应用.doc

上传人:gnk289057 文档编号:5912414 上传时间:2019-03-21 格式:DOC 页数:8 大小:701.50KB
下载 相关 举报
视觉传感器在S7300中的应用.doc_第1页
第1页 / 共8页
视觉传感器在S7300中的应用.doc_第2页
第2页 / 共8页
视觉传感器在S7300中的应用.doc_第3页
第3页 / 共8页
视觉传感器在S7300中的应用.doc_第4页
第4页 / 共8页
视觉传感器在S7300中的应用.doc_第5页
第5页 / 共8页
点击查看更多>>
资源描述

1、SIMATIC VS130 视觉传感器在 S7 300 中的应用我公司 GF6 自动变速箱车间装配生产线广泛运用西门子 S7 300 PLC 控制系统,SIMATIC S7-300 是一种通用型 PLC,能适合自动化工程中的各种应用场合,尤其是在生产制造工程中的应用。它功能强大,能将各种生产工具如扫描仪,拧紧枪、压机、视觉传感器以及各种测量系统等通过硬件组态和软件编程联系起来,实现生产过程的自动化。 关键词: VS130 视觉传感器 S7-300 PLC PROFIBUS DP 引言:随着现代经济的不断发展,社会的高度信息化,新的高科技技术不断应用到各方面生产领域中,使得智能化成为必然趋势。尤

2、其是PLC在自动化设备上的运用,以及PLC控制器的升级,功能的扩大,再加上一些外围控制器的链接运用,完全使得高技术运用成为必然,本文所描述的是有着世界先进水平的SIMATIC VS130系列视觉传感器(工业照相机)在西门子S7-300控制系统中的应用。一 SIMATIC VS130视觉传感器的工作原理 SIMATIC VS130 视觉传感器能够处理(侦测和解码) 符合ECC200标准的二维码。 即使是在恶劣的环境中, 它也能自动的正常的工作。强大的功能使其甚至能够处理扭曲、旋转和有强烈反射的表面。SIMATIC VS 130 能够识别多种编码载体,支持打印码、机械码和光刻码。人性化的设计使得操

3、作非常简单,采用 示教 替代编程,无需专业的图像处理知识。对VS 130的示教可以直接通过集成在控制器上的按键和屏幕实现。 通过PROFIBUS DP或RS串行通讯接口的远程控制非常方便。 调试过程中可以在PC上监测传感器的图像。与定义的数值(数字输出)进行比较,通过PROFIBUS至PLC的串行或以太网接口传输,PLC随后会对相应的搬运设备进行控制。可以为读取的代码选择一种质量测试。(一)系统组成:完整的视觉传感器 SIMATIC VS130 由下列各项组成: 带 CCD 传感芯片的探测头(CCD = 电荷耦合装置),用于检测代码 LED 顶部照明装置,红色,环形闪光灯的防护级别为 IP65

4、 (订货号为6GF9 004-8BA01;仅对 VS130-2) 处理单元,用于代码处理、结果输出、PROFIBUS DP 和 PROFINET I/O 通讯及参数分配 用于连接各个组件的电缆(二) 处理配置:通过一个合适的传送带将包含代码的对象传送到探测头。当读取时,它们必须完全位于传感器的视野内。在培训模式中,保存代码的字符内容。在处理模式中,读取当前代码与已培训代码所保存的内容进行比较。 根据读取结果设置数字输出信号: READ (定位并解码代码)、MATCH (代码与已培训代码相匹配)、N_OK (代码不可辨认)。根据参数设置,通过 PROFIBUS DP、PROFINET IO 或

5、RS-232 以太网接口转换器的 RS-232 接口或 TCP 服务器输出读取结果。通过显示面板上的菜单指导操作。 在显示面板的前三行中显示菜单条目。 光标“指向选定的菜单条目。 在显示面板的第 4 行,可以看到当前可使用的控制面板的按钮(确定、ESC、s、t、 、 )。 通过控制面板的按钮,可在菜单内浏览,并从一个菜单转移到另一个菜单: 通过箭头按钮“s“和“t“,可以上下移动光标,选择所需要的菜单命令。 通过“确定“按钮,可以确认选择,并前进到下一步。 通过“ESC“按钮,可以打开上一个菜单。(三)调整传感器调试 SIMATIC VS130 之前,必须使用基于 Web 的安装支持正确调整探

6、测头。 之后,可以看到探测头观察到的图像。步骤 动作1 1. 通过 Internet Explorer 接通 PC 或 PG。接通处理单元。建立处理单元与 PC/PG 之间的 TCP/IP 连接。 可直接通过跨接电缆或通过在现有网络中接入处理单元来完成该操作。 在在线帮助中详细描述了这两种可选方法。通过 Internet Explorer 输入处理单元的地址。结果:一旦启动安装支持,就会在 PC/PG 监视器上显示传感器的视野。 每秒钟多次更新所显示的图像。 2 调整传感器1. 将代码放到图像中。通过正确调整探测头末端与代码之间的距离,设置一个清晰图像。如有必要,更正快门速度和亮度,或使用其中

7、一种自动模式(自动 V1 或自动)。通过以较小的角度浏览代码,将反射光降至最小。激活“仅当触发时“复选框来测试触发信号和触发设置(触发源)。按要求调整更多设置。注意:如果错误太多,则使用一块无棉绒的布料清洁镜头和漫射器。3 固定传感器,然后检查传感器位置是否正确。4 调整其它参数设置。5 检查读取结果。6 设置参数,以指定过程接口。7 如果已知代码,则培训代码。8 切换到处理模式(“运行“)。9 分析可能发生的任何错误。(四)在 HW Config 中集成 DP 从站 VS130-2设备主数据文件 SIEM8111.GSD 包含 VS130-2 DP 标准从站的 PROFIBUS 属性。 如果

8、使用低于 V5.3 SP1 的 STEP 7 版本,则 HW Config 的模块目录中不包括视觉传感器 VS130-2。 在这种情况下,必须通过“选项 安装 GSD.“将其添加到目录中。相应的位图文件 VS1X0_N.DIB 必须和 GSD 文件位于相同的文件夹中。然后在“PROFIBUS DP 附加现场设备常规机器视角“下的模块目录中显示视觉传感器 VS130-2 (参见下面的屏幕画面)。 在本例中,VS130-2 的控制字节被设为输出地址 0,VS130-2 的状态字节被设为CPU 的输入地址 0 (DP 主站,插槽 1)。 如果这些地址均位于 OB1 的过程映像中(过程映像分区“OB1

9、 PI“),则可通过过程映像访问在 OB1 中操作(例如,“A I0.6“或“S Q0.1“)。视觉传感器 VS130-2 的 16 个字长的连续通讯区的起始地址设为输入地址 1 和输出地址 1 (插槽 2)。 如果这些地址均位于 OB1 的过程映像中(过程映像分区“OB1 PI“),则可通过过程映像访问在 OB1 中操作(例如,“L EW 2“、“T AB 1“),而不会破坏一致性。如果这些地址不在 OB1 的过程映像内,则必须使用 SFC 14“DPRD_DAT“和 15“DPWR_DAT“来访问 VS130-2 的通讯区,以确保一致性。 在处理单元的“设置 端口 DP 地址“菜单中设置

10、VS130-2 的 PROFIBUS 地址。不支持通过 PROFIBUS 修改 PROFIBUS 地址。如果通过 PROFIBUS 给视觉传感器VS130-2 分配参数值,则只能设置其缺省值(全部为零)。 如果在此输入非零数值,则产生一条从站诊断消息(“无效 DP 参数“)。 如果将 S7 CPU 作为 DP 主站,则触发诊断中断(由于 CPU 处于 STOP 模式,没有启动 OB82): 在诊断缓冲区中输入“故障模块“,“SF“LED 点亮。 二 西门子 S7-300 PLC 的工作原理 SIMATIC S7-300 能适合自动化工程中的各种应用场合,尤其是在生产制造工程中的应用。模块化、无

11、排风扇结构、易于实现分布式的配置、以及用户易于掌握等特点,使得 S7-300 在以下工业部门中实施各种控制任务时,成为一种既经济又切合实际的解决方案。S7-300 具有以下显著特点: 循环周期短、处理速度高 指令集功能强大、可用于复杂功能 产品设计紧凑、可用于空间有限的场合 有不同档次的CPU、各种各样的功能模块和I/O 模块可供选择 已检定合格的、可在恶劣气候条件下露天使用的模块类型S7-300 的硬件结构1.负载电源(选项) 6.存储卡(CPU313以上)2.后备电池(CPU313以上) 7.MPI多点接口3.24V DC连接 8.前连接器4.模式开关 9.前门5.状态和故障指示灯结构性能

12、概述SIMATIC S7-300 可编程序控制器是模块化结构设计,各种单独的模块之间可进行广泛组合以用于扩展。从左向右依次排列:。负载电源模块(PS):用于将S7-300连接到120/230V AC电源,并转换为24V,供CPU 和I/O模块使用。中央处理器单元(CPU):各种CPU有各种不同的性能,例如,有的CPU上集成有PRFIBUS-DP通讯接口等。通信处理器(CP):用于连接网络和点对点连接,用于PLC与计算机和其它智能设备之间的通信可以将PLC接入PROFIBUS,AS-I和工业以太网,或用于实现点对点信号。信号模块(SM):用于数字量输入/输出,信号模块是数字量输入/输出和模拟量I

13、/O的总称,它们使不同的过程信号电压或电流,与PLC内部信号电平匹配,信号模块SM321(IM),SM322(OUT)。模拟量输入SM331(IN),SM332(OUT)。模拟量输入模块(热电阻,热电偶,DC 4-20MA,0-10V),每个模块上有一个背板总线连接器,现场过程信号连接到前连接器的端子上。功能模块(FM):主要用于对实时性和存储容量,要求高的控制任务,用于高数计数,定位操作(开环或闭环控制)和闭环控制,例如:计数器模块,快速/慢速进给驱动位置控制模块,电子凸轮控制模块,步进电动机定位模块,伺服电动机定位模块,定位和连续路径控制模块,闭环控制模块,工业标识系统的接口模块,称重模块

14、,位置输入模块,超声波位置解码器。接口模块(IM):用于多机架配置时连接主机架(CR)和扩展机架(ER),S7-300通信分布式的主机架和3个扩展机架,最多可安装配置32个信号模块,功能模块和通信处理器。其中每个机架(CR/ER)可以插入8个模块。通过接口模块连接,每个机架上都有它自己的接口模块。它总是插在CPU旁边的槽内,负责与其它扩展机架自动地进行通讯.三 Profibus-DP的功能特点PROFIBUS现场总线是一种国际化的、开放的、不依赖于设备生产商的现场总线标准。它广泛适用于制造业自动化、流程工业自动化和楼宇、交通、电力等其他领域自动化。PROFIBUS由三个兼容部分组成:PROFI

15、BUSFMS、PROFIBUSDP、PROFIBUSPA。DP主要用于现场级的高速数据传输(96kbitS12Mbits),解决自动控制系统通过高速串行总线与分散的现场设备之间的通信任务,传输技术主要用RS485,PROFIBUS-DP的通信任务是由一些固定服务(SAP)来完成的。DP从站能够接PROFIBUS的PLC或PC主站的控制数据,构成一个数字化、智能双向、多点的现场总线通信网络,实现最优控制;而且DP智能从站执行器具有可靠性高、性价比高等特点,因此开发智能化DP从站具有巨大的前景。 Profibus-DP的特性及系统组成Profibus-DP使用物理层,数据链接层和用户接口,用于现场

16、层的高速数据传送。主站周期地读取从站地输入信息并周期地向从站发送输出信息。总线循环时间必须要比主站程序循环时间短。此外,PROFIBUS-DP还提供智能化现场设备所需的非周期性通信以进行组态、诊断和报警处理及复杂设备在运行中参数的确定。Profibus-DP基本功能和特性如下:(1) 远距离高速通信支持9.6Kbps到12Mbps的传输速率; 12Mbps时最大传输距离为100m,1.5Mbps时为200m,另外还可以用中继器延长;(2) 分布式结构各主站间令牌传递,主站与从站为主从传送;每段可有32个站,用连接线可扩展到126个站;(3) 易于安装,开放式的通讯网络;(4) 可靠性高,具备自

17、诊断功能。 Profibus-DP主站分为一类主站和二类主站。一类主站完成总线通信控制与管理,完成周期性数据访问,包括PLC、PC或可做一类主站的控制器。二类主站完成非周期性数据访问,如数据读写、系统配置、故障诊断等,包括操作员工作站(如PC机加图形监控软件)、编程器、HMI等。PROFIBUS- DP从站主要进行输入、输出信号采集和发送,包括PLC或其他控制器、分散式I/O、智能现场设备等。PROFIBUS 协议的优点在于: PROFIBUS 通讯速率快,最高可达12Mbit/S, 8个节点的网络系统的总线循环时间最快可至0.2ms。尤其适合于高实时性和高动态响应要求的应用场合。 每个总线节

18、点的单帧最大数据传输长度可达244字节,通讯效率高。当与驱动装置、机器人、PLC等进行整个参数的传输时能确保在一个数据帧内完成,从而,确保设备启动的安全性和快速响应能力。 网络中如有一处节点发生故障,不影响网络中其它节点的正常工作,且网络无需重新初始化,从而避免了短时的通讯中断。 支持总线型、星型、环形、树型等网络拓扑结构,适用于各种工业现场布局和特殊工艺要求。 网络规模大,采用光纤可构建100 公里范围的工业网络系统。 特有的两线传输和屏蔽技术,有效抑制干扰,实现最佳的电磁兼容性。 PROFIBUS提供强大的系统级故障诊断能力,从总线系统的任意一点可通过PROFIBUS-DP 进行诊断、编程、和控制。采用PROFIBUS诊断中继器可以实时精确定位故障发生点和在线监控通讯负荷,并可通过人机界面概述小结S7 300 PLC CPU 具有更快处理速度,软件编辑功能强大,网络通讯强大(以太网,现场总线,MPI) ,通过 GSD 文件控制其它厂商模块。控制功能强大(通过功能模块可实现高速记数,伺服定位,模拟量转换,空间传送,影像转换等) 。

展开阅读全文
相关资源
猜你喜欢
相关搜索

当前位置:首页 > 学术论文 > 大学论文

本站链接:文库   一言   我酷   合作


客服QQ:2549714901微博号:道客多多官方知乎号:道客多多

经营许可证编号: 粤ICP备2021046453号世界地图

道客多多©版权所有2020-2025营业执照举报